This is a Model created by my Software Prometheus developed in the past to supply Multisim/EWB with Simultation Models.NTC Level 1

 

The level 1 model of the NTC (Negative Temperature
Coefficient) is based on the basic NTC
equation which uses the B constant.

 

NTC Level 2
This model is based on the Steinhart-Hart equation
and can reproduce the nonlinear characteristics
better than the level 1 model. However it need more
simulation time.

 

Hope the two samples help.

 

* 0.1K1A1 ; NTC ; BetaTHERM ; BETA11
* Level 1 (von Wangenheim)
*
* Self heating
.SUBCKT BET_0.1K1A1 1 2
* | |
* TERMINALS: | B
* A
*
* PACKAGE: BETA11
* TEMPERATURE-RANGE: -55°C ... 100°C
*
V1 1 4 DC 0
R1 4 5 100
R2 8 0 500 RMOD
R3 9 0 7.38368E+05
R4 7 0 999.9999
R5 10 2 0.83932
B1 5 10 V=I(V1)*100*(EXP(3103.986/V(6)-3103.986/298.15)-1)
B2 0 7 I=ABS(V(1,10))*ABS(I(V1))
B3 6 0 V=(273.15+((V(8,0)/500)-1)*1000)+V(7)
C1 7 0 0.012
I1 0 8 1
.MODEL RMOD R(TC1=0.001 TNOM = 0)
*
* DATASHEET/DATABOOK: 1996-1997 Catalog
*
* VERSION: 2.0/1
* (C) Alexander Ehle/Stuttgart 08.04.99 09:54:21 Prometheus V2.0.0
*
.ENDS

 

* 0.1K1A1 ; NTC ; BetaTHERM ; BETA11
* Level 2 (Ehle)
*
* Self heating
.SUBCKT BET_0.1K1A1 1 2
* | |
* TERMINALS: | B
* A
*
* PACKAGE: BETA11
* TEMPERATURE-RANGE: -55°C ... 100°C
*
V1 1 4 DC 0
V2 9 0 DC 1
R1 4 20 1E+12
R2 8 0 500 RMOD
R3 19 0 7.38368E+05
R4 7 0 999.9999
R5 20 2 0.83932
C1 7 0 0.012
I1 0 8 1
B1 0 7 I=ABS(V(1,20))*ABS(I(V1))
B2 4 20 I=V(4,20)/(EXP(V(18)-V(17))+1E-12)
B3 6 0 V=(273.15+(((V(8,0)/500)-1)*1000))+V(7)
B4 10 0 V=(((1.942928E-03-(1/V(6)))/3.507238E-07)/2)
B5 11 0 V=(((1.942928E-03-(1/V(6)))/3.507238E-07)^2)/4
B6 12 0 V=V(9)*(((852.4542)^3)/27)
B7 13 0 V=ABS(V(11)+V(12))
B8 14 0 V=EXP(1/2*LN(ABS(V(13))))
B9 15 0 V=ABS(V(10)+V(14))
B10 16 0 V=ABS(V(10)-V(14))
B11 17 0 V=EXP(1/3*LN(ABS(V(15))))
B12 18 0 V=EXP(1/3*LN(ABS(V(16))))
.MODEL RMOD R(TC1=0.001 TNOM = 0)
*
* DATASHEET/DATABOOK: 1996-1997 Catalog
*
* VERSION: 2.0/1
* (C) Alexander Ehle/Stuttgart 08.04.99 09:54:21 Prometheus V2.0.0
*
.ENDS
